CVE-2022-31993
CRITICALCVSS 9.8/10EPSS 1.07%
Last modified
CVE-2022-31993 is a critical-severity vulnerability rated 9.8/10 on the CVSS scale. Badminton Center Management System v1.0 is vulnerable to SQL Injection via /bcms/classes/Master.php?f=delete_service.. EPSS estimates a 1.07% chance of exploitation in the next 30 days.
